Lawn Dart
Add lime juice, agave syrup and pepper to mixing tin and muddle. Add tequila, gin, and Chartreuse and shake. Fine strain into a Collins filled with ice, top with club soda.

Great cocktail! I liked it best with 1.25 oz of tequila, a generous slice of pepper, and more like .6 oz of agave. I also found it's important that the green pepper have a perfectly ripe sweetness to it; a bland or undersweet green pepper can somehow create an almost chlorinated taste in this drink. So taste test your pepper before muddling!
